Gå til innhold

Diskeeper warning men får ikke fikset !


Anbefalte innlegg

Videoannonse
Annonse

Tar jeg ikke helt feil så er MTF "Master File Table", en liste som holder rede på hvor dine filer ligger på disken.

 

 

Kan tyde på at du har såpass mange filer på disken slik at den begynner å nå sin maks naturlige størrelse. Det at denne filen blir fragmentert, betyr at fortsettelsen på filen vil bli lagt et annen sted på disken. Tror ikke dette gjør stort i det lange løp, men men.

 

Hvor mange filer har du på denne disken ?

 

*****

MFT Reservation and Fragmentation

 

MFT contains frequently used system files and indexes, so performance of MFT affects a lot to the entire volume performance.

 

By default NTFS reserves zone, 12.5% of volume size for MFT and does not allow writing there any user's data, which lets MFT to grow. However, when, for example, a lot of files are placed to the drive, MFT can grow beyond the reserved zone and becomes fragmented. Another reason is when you delete file, NTFS does not always use its space in MFT to store new one, it just marks MFT entry as deleted and allocates new entry for the new file. It provides some performance and recovery benefits, however it forces MFT to be fragmented.

 

The more MFT fragmentation, the more the HDD heads movements to access the data, the less overall performance of file system.

 

Starting from Windows NT 4.0 SP4 you can define MFT Zone Reservation value through the Registry.

Key: H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\FileSystem

Value NtfsMftZoneReservation of DWORD type (1 to 4) allows you to specify MFT Zone for the newly created/formatted volumes(12.5 percent, 25 percent, 37.5 percent, 50 percent of NTFS volume accordingly)

****

 

Mye her som tyder på at din MFT inneholder mye søppel, filer du har slettet for lenge siden med mere.

Endret av Ulkesh
Lenke til kommentar

Høres ut som om disken muligens er moden for en formatering, ja. Jeg argumenterer sjeldent for formatering for å løse problemer, men akkurat her vil jeg anbefale det.

 

Jeg legger selv inn Windows på nytt minst 2 ganger årlig, har kompilert en CD med ting jeg alltid legger inn på nytt for enkelhets skyld. Selv med bra vedlikehold av Windows klarer man ikke å holde systemet 100 % rent.

 

26 401 filer er ikke så ille, men jeg tror nok at din MFT inneholder langt over det fil-antallet du har i dag.

 

Edit :

 

Noe som slo meg er at dette kan være et resultat av at du har definert veldig mange punkt for system-gjennoppretting ?

Endret av Ulkesh
Lenke til kommentar

MFT-størrelsen settes automatisk når du formaterer harddisken. Når du har kommet opp i et visst antall filer så er ikke den avsatte plassen nok. Da avsettes andre områder på harddisken til MFT i tillegg. Problemet er at dette går ut over ytelsen. MFT burde være samlet på 1 stort område nær begynnelsen av disken. I diskkeeper kan du manuellt utvide MFT slik at denne ikke blir spredd over altfor store deler av disken. Du gjør dette under Configuration->Frag Shield.

Lenke til kommentar

Det er virkelig morsomt dette. Du har en ca 70GB partition ,du har ca 82% ledig,

du har ca 21000 filer, og etter det jeg ser du har en MTF file som er stor nok til å søve i.

Jeg tror helst at parametere her er ikke helt gode.

Men du kan godt bruke ---analyser ---på diskdefragmentering i Datamaskinbehandling----vis rapport--.

Her du kan se antall filer ,fragmenter. og hvor mange MB er MTF din, og hvor mye er i bruk.

De warnings som du får fra det prog ,......å javel sier eg.....

 

 

 

Antall MB og % brukt, skal du se etter på raporten laget fra Windows.

Se, om det stemmer med det du får fra Diskprog.

Endret av wiberos
Lenke til kommentar

Tviler sterkt på at MFT faktisk tar 12.5 % av *hele* disken. Denne verdien kan settes til 100 %, så dette blir feil logikk. Da kan ikke disken brukes til noe.

 

Dersom 38 MB MFT er 68 % av maks, da vil 55.7 MB være 100 % maks MFT. Dersom MFT er 12.5 % av reservert filsystem, er hele filsystemet på 445.6 MB reservert til å holde orden på resten av disken.

Endret av Ulkesh
Lenke til kommentar
Hjelpe meg ?

 

untitled3wi.th.jpg

 

 

Tror kanskje programmet overreagerer ?

 

Format blir løsning om ikke annet ...

5895498[/snapback]

 

Det er vel bare å utvide det? Og selv om du ikke vil gjøre det, så er ikke akkurat en formatering tvingende nødvendig, er ikke akkurat som om det er en kritisk feil.

 

AtW

Lenke til kommentar
Tviler sterkt på at MFT faktisk tar 12.5 % av *hele* disken. Denne verdien kan settes til 100 %, så dette blir feil logikk. Da kan ikke disken brukes til noe.

 

Dersom 38 MB MFT er 68 % av maks, da vil 55.7 MB være 100 % maks MFT. Dersom MFT er 12.5 % av reservert filsystem, er hele filsystemet på 445.6 MB reservert til å holde orden på resten av disken.

5895182[/snapback]

 

 

Hei , 68% av 38MB. som er tildelt. Det betyr at jeg har 12.16 MB ledig av de 38MB før det vil begynner å fragmentere.

Men på mitt system partition som er på ca 8GB har jeg da en MFT på 38MB hvor 68% er brukt opp og jeg har da ledig ca 3,5Gb igjen på HD.

Så om jeg hadde fylt disken min nå ville MFT file min og it's størrelse væra OK for å registre filene ,.....sant?

Det er veldig enkelt forklart., det er mer vedrårende MFT, men håper at jeg ga en ca forklaring.

Lenke til kommentar
Hjelpe meg ?

 

untitled3wi.th.jpg

 

 

Tror kanskje programmet overreagerer ?

 

Format blir løsning om ikke annet ...

5895498[/snapback]

 

Jeg tror at programmet bruker values som er optimale i den sammenheng om at du har veldig mange små files. Små filer kan lagres totalt inn i MFT og dermed fylle opp.

Ikke glem da at windows vil utvide MFT størrelse automatisk.

Til normal bruk ser ikke noe fare med det.

Men du kan sette opp verdien i :

H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Filesystem... for NtfsMftZoneReservation......0x00000002(2)

NtfsDisableLastAccessUpdate ....0x00000001(1).(her deaktiverer du "last accessed" informastion for filene.

 

Som andre ågsa har nevnt, dette er ikke noe problem. Jeg tror at du kommer til å formatere mange ganger i mellomtiden av helt andre grunner, og ikke dette.

Endret av wiberos
Lenke til kommentar
Så du mener at jeg ikke burde formatere i dette tilfellet ?

 

Slik ser det ut i min regedit ... Hmm ikke noe lignende du reffererer til :

 

untitled4xa.th.jpg

5899586[/snapback]

 

Sorry..

 

Siden du har ikke verdiene der ,du må skrive inn :

Der du er ---klick edit--NY (new)---DWORD verdi. Det skrives automatisk en ny felt,

og i felten så skriver du nøyaktig "NtfsMftZoneReservation" (uten anførselstegn) tast enter eller klick på et sted på skrivebord.

Deretter høyreklick på den du nettop har laget og velg Endre. Nå kan du skrive 2 i felten under verdidata--klick OK.

 

Det samme kan du gjøre med "NtfsDisableLastAccessUpdate" (uten anførselstegn) som gjør at windows

slutter å skrive update data for når en mappe eller file sist ble acceced eller forandret. Den default verdi er (0). Skriver du (1) så slutter windows med det.

Du forstår betydning av det . I posten fra Ulkesh er noe mer å lese angående MFTZone.

Lenke til kommentar

Opprett en konto eller logg inn for å kommentere

Du må være et medlem for å kunne skrive en kommentar

Opprett konto

Det er enkelt å melde seg inn for å starte en ny konto!

Start en konto

Logg inn

Har du allerede en konto? Logg inn her.

Logg inn nå
×
×
  • Opprett ny...